Yeocheon Middle School met with the Armed Forces Sports Unit’s Sangmu Basketball Team through the “Elite Used Basketball Talent Donation Program” at Heungkuk Indoor Gymnasium in Yeosu, Jeollanam-do, on the 23rd. Shin Jin-soo, a third grader at Yeocheon Middle School who finished the program, thanked him for creating a talent donation time. “When I look back, it’s not an easy opportunity, but I’m grateful to the federation, the managing director, and the middle and high school coaches for creating a good opportunity,” he said.
The player Shin Jin-soo wanted to meet the most through talent donation is Heo Hoon.
Shin Jin-soo said, “It was really nice to meet the players I wanted to see. It was especially good to meet Heo Hoon, who is famous and handsome. I like my alma mater senior Kim Nak-hyun, but I like Huh Hoon more,” he said with a smile.
“I learned the basics, but it felt different because the players taught me one by one. “It was a very valuable time,” he said. “When I first heard the news of talent donation, I was nervous and worried that it would be hard, but it was a really fun and good time.”
Shin Jin-soo, who first started playing basketball in fifth grade, expressed confidence as an advantage.
Shin Jin-soo said, “I’m confident in blocks in outer shots, breakthroughs, and defense. “I want to be a versatile player,” he said. “I want to grow up and become a good player, and then come to my alma mater like Sangmu players and donate my talent like this.”
